Physician assistant employment is projected by the US Bureau of Labor Statistics to grow 27 percent from 2022 to 2032. This number is significantly higher than the three percent growth projection for all occupations. U.S. News and World Report listed physician assistant as the number two most in-demand job across occupations for 2024.
